Lil Wayne is under fire for his recent comments during an interview on Nightline where he was asked for his thoughts on the #BlackLivesMatter movement.
The Grammy-winning hip-hop artist was dismissive when Nightline reporter Lindsey Davis asked his thoughts on social issues. In a preview clip of the interview, Davis addressed the Black Lives Matter movement, to which Wayne responds: โWhat is it? What does it mean?โ
And when asked if he felt drawn to the movement, he answers: โI donโt feel connected to a damn thing that ainโt got nothinโ to do with me.โ He went on to explain, โIโm a young black rich mother****er. If that donโt let you know that America understand.โ
Back in September, Lil Wayne shared a similar, sentiment toward the movement by saying that there is โno such thing as racismโ because there are usually a lot of white fans at his concerts.
